Conversion Formula for Maxwell to Microweber
The formula of conversion of Maxwell to Microweber is very simple. To convert Maxwell to Microweber, we can use this simple formula:
1 Maxwell = 0.01 Microweber
1 Microweber = 100 Maxwell
One Maxwell is equal to 0.01 Microweber. So, we need to multiply the number of Maxwell by 0.01 to get the no of Microweber. This formula helps when we need to change the measurements from Maxwell to Microweber

Details for Maxwell (CGS Flux Unit)
Introduction : The maxwell serves as the fundamental unit of magnetic flux in the CGS system, where 1 Mx equals 10⁻⁸ weber. Though largely replaced by SI units, the maxwell remains important for understanding historical scientific work and certain specialized physics applications.
History & Origin : Named after James Clerk Maxwell, the Scottish physicist who formulated classical electromagnetic theory. This unit dominated magnetic measurements until the mid-20th century when SI units became standard.
Current Use : Still appears in some material science research, older engineering documents, and specialized physics applications. Essential for interpreting historical magnetic measurements and certain legacy calibration standards.
Details for Microweber (Precision Flux Unit)
Introduction : The microweber represents one-millionth of a weber, enabling precise measurement of very small magnetic fluxes. This unit is particularly valuable in scientific research and high-precision instrumentation where minute magnetic effects must be quantified with exceptional accuracy.
History & Origin : Came into common use with advancements in sensitive measurement technologies during the late 20th century. The microweber became essential for nanotechnology research and quantum physics experiments requiring extreme measurement precision.
Current Use : Critical in measuring weak magnetic fields, testing sensitive electronic components, and calibrating medical imaging equipment. Used in geomagnetic studies, material science research, and development of miniature electromagnetic devices where tiny flux values are significant.
